Output 80c514b2a53a88133cff2f4ceb56d23bb8e39a840f9d304c67caefed3b0b20fe:1

value
290806281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a653c9f6a08d8d3584424d871f776ee8ce9956b5 OP_EQUAL
address
3GrUU9Hy4queb6t21QBLi6WtVYpYzJBMbL
transaction
80c514b2a53a88133cff2f4ceb56d23bb8e39a840f9d304c67caefed3b0b20fe
spent
true